揭秘全面的iOS签名技术指南-详解苹果签名

在苹果设备中,每一个应用程序都需要经过签名机制才能正常运行。签名机制可以保证应用程序的安全性和完整性。iOS签名主要包括苹果签名、企业签名等多种类型。在本文中,我们将详细解释苹果签名并提供一些使用它的技巧ios企业证书名字是什么。

什么是苹果签名?

苹果签名是iOS设备上的一种认证机制,用于验证一个应用程序的身份。每一个应用程序都会被验证,以确保它来自可信任的来源并且在传输过程中未被篡改。

苹果签名使用了一种称为数字证书(Digital Certificate)的技术来验证应用程序。数字证书是一个带有公钥和私钥的数据文件。应用程序的开发者使用私钥来生成数字证书,并将其向苹果公司提交审核后,若审核通过则苹果公司将授权数字证书并将其添加到开发者账号中。iOS设备使用公钥来对数字证书进行验证来检查应用程序的合法性。

苹果签名的优点

苹果签名机制具有以下优点:

保证应用程序的安全性和完整性;

防止未经授权的应用程序在iOS设备上运行,从而保证iOS设备的稳定性和安全性;

防止应用程序被篡改,从而保护用户隐私;

保证App Store中的应用程序能够正常运行。

如何执行苹果签名?

在应用程序开发的过程中,开发者必须首先向苹果公司提交应用程序的源代码,并使用私钥生成数字证书。若应用程序通过了审核,苹果公司将会签名审核通过的应用程序。

苹果签名的执行流程如下:

应用程序的开发者在苹果开发者中心中创建证书请求(certificate request);

苹果公司对开发者的证书请求进行审核,并生成一个数字证书;苹果企业签和个人签

开发者在Xcode中添加数字证书,并将其添加到代码签名过程中;

开发者通过Xcode将应用程序上传至苹果公司进行审核;

苹果公司对应用程序进行审核,并签署数字证书;

iOS设备下载应用程序时对数字证书进行验证;

若应用程序经验证后通过,则iOS设备下载并运行该应用程序。iphone企业信任不见了

结论

苹果签名是iOS设备上一个非常重要的组成部分。它可以保证应用程序的安全性和完整性,并防止iOS设备被恶???软件侵害。通过这篇文章的阐述,您应该已经了解了苹果签名机制的工作原理和优点,以及如何执行苹果签名。在开发应用程序时,请确保按照规定的流程进行签名,以确保应用程序的有效性和安全性。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。